Software Engineer, Account Abuse

Software Engineer, Account Abuse

Vollzeit Homeoffice (teilweise)
A

Auf einen Blick

  • Aufgaben: Build systems to analyze signals at scale and create monitoring dashboards.
  • Unternehmen: Anthropic focuses on creating reliable and interpretable AI systems for societal benefit.
  • Vorteile: Annual compensation ranges from $320,000 to $405,000 USD with visa sponsorship available.
  • Weitere Informationen: Hybrid work policy requires staff to be in the office at least 25% of the time.
  • Warum dieser Job: Join a rapidly growing team dedicated to building beneficial AI systems.
  • Qualifikationen: Requires a Bachelor’s degree and 5-10+ years in software engineering, preferably in abuse detection.

Über Anthropic

Anthropic’s Mission ist es, zuverlässige, interpretierbare und steuerbare KI-Systeme zu schaffen. Wir möchten, dass KI sicher und vorteilhaft für unsere Nutzer und die Gesellschaft als Ganzes ist. Unser Team ist eine schnell wachsende Gruppe von engagierten Forschern, Ingenieuren, Politikspezialisten und Geschäftsführern, die zusammenarbeiten, um nützliche KI-Systeme zu entwickeln.

Über die Rolle

Das Account Abuse-Team hat die Aufgabe, sicherzustellen, dass die Rechenkapazität von Anthropic fair zugewiesen wird, indem die Ressourcen für böswillige Akteure minimiert und deren Rückkehr verhindert wird. Als Software-Ingenieur in diesem Team werden Sie Systeme entwickeln, die Signale in großem Maßstab sammeln und analysieren, Kompromisse abwägen und eng mit den Stakeholder-Teams im gesamten Unternehmen zusammenarbeiten.

Der ideale Kandidat kann die Perspektiven der Gegner verstehen, ihre Mittel und Motive erkennen und ihre Reaktionen auf Gegenmaßnahmen antizipieren.

Verantwortlichkeiten

  • Fähigkeit, schnell in einer sich schnell ändernden Umgebung zu denken und zu reagieren.
  • Einblick in den Code anderer Teams, um wichtige Punkte zur Signalbeschaffung oder zur Einführung von Interventionen mit minimalen Auswirkungen auf die Stabilität, Komplexität oder Gesamtarchitektur ihrer Systeme zu identifizieren.
  • Integration mit Drittanbietern zur Datenanreicherung.
  • Erstellung von Überwachungs-Dashboards, Alarmen und internen Admin-UX.
  • Enge Zusammenarbeit mit unseren Datenwissenschaftlern, um ein situatives Bewusstsein für unsere aktuellen Nutzungsmuster und -trends aufrechtzuerhalten, sowie mit unserem Policy & Enforcement-Team, um die Auswirkungen ihrer Verfügbarkeit für menschliche Überprüfungen zu maximieren.
  • Aufbau robuster und zuverlässiger mehrschichtiger Verteidigungen.
  • Leitung von Ursachenanalysen und tiefgehenden Untersuchungen zu Kontoaktivitäten, um Missbrauchsmuster zu identifizieren, aufkommende Angriffsvektoren aufzudecken und sowohl sofortige Durchsetzungsmaßnahmen als auch langfristige systemische Verteidigungen zu informieren.

Qualifikationen

  • Ein Bachelor-Abschluss in Informatik, Softwaretechnik oder vergleichbarer Erfahrung.
  • 5-10+ Jahre Erfahrung in einer Position der Softwareentwicklung, vorzugsweise mit einem Fokus auf Integrität, Spam, Betrug oder Missbrauchserkennung.
  • Kenntnisse in Python, SQL und Datenanalysetools.
  • Starke Kommunikationsfähigkeiten und die Fähigkeit, komplexe technische Konzepte nicht-technischen Stakeholdern zu erklären.
  • Optional: Erfahrung im Aufbau von Vertrauens- und Sicherheitsmechanismen für und mit KI/ML-Systemen, wie z.B. Betrugserkennungsmodelle oder Sicherheitsüberwachungstools oder die Infrastruktur zur Unterstützung dieser Systeme in großem Maßstab.
  • Optional: Enge Zusammenarbeit mit operativen Teams zur Erstellung maßgeschneiderter interner Werkzeuge.

Vergütung

Die jährliche Vergütungsbandbreite für diese Rolle liegt zwischen 320.000 und 405.000 USD.

Logistik

  • Minimale Ausbildung: Bachelor-Abschluss oder eine gleichwertige Kombination aus Ausbildung, Schulung und/oder Erfahrung.
  • Erforderliches Studienfeld: Ein für die Rolle relevantes Feld, das durch Kursarbeit, Schulung oder berufliche Erfahrung nachgewiesen wird.
  • Minimale Jahre an Erfahrung: Die erforderlichen Jahre an Erfahrung korrelieren mit den internen Anforderungen an das Joblevel für die Position.
  • Standortbasierte Hybridpolitik: Derzeit erwarten wir, dass alle Mitarbeiter mindestens 25% der Zeit in einem unserer Büros sind. Einige Rollen können jedoch mehr Zeit in unseren Büros erfordern.
  • Visumsponsoring: Wir sponsern Visa.

Wir sponsern Visa!

Software Engineer, Account Abuse Arbeitgeber: Anthropic

Anthropic is located in a hybrid work environment, promoting collaboration among researchers and engineers. The mission is to ensure AI systems are safe and beneficial, making it an exciting place for those passionate about technology and ethics.

A

Kontaktdaten:

Anthropic Recruiting-Team

StudySmarter Expertenrat🤫

Wir sind der Meinung, dass Sie so Software Engineer, Account Abuse erhalten könnten

Engagier dich in Entwickler-Communities!

Lass uns mal ehrlich sein: In der Software-Entwicklung sind Netzwerke Gold wert! Tummel dich in GitHub-Projekten, nehme an lokalen Meetups oder Hackathons teil und vernetze dich mit anderen Entwicklern. So steigerst du nicht nur deine Sichtbarkeit, sondern lernst auch die neuesten Trends und Technologien kennen.

Zeig deine Fähigkeiten!

Erstelle ein Portfolio, das deine besten Projekte und Code-Examples zeigt. Nichts überzeugt mehr als ein praktischer Beweis deiner Skills. Das kann auch helfen, bei Anthropic anzuklopfen, wenn du dich auf die Stelle als Software Engineer, Account Abuse bewirbst – so wissen sie gleich, was sie von dir erwarten können!

Nutze Jobplattformen speziell für Tech-Jobs!

Plattformen wie Stack Overflow Jobs oder AngelsList sind perfekte Orte, um Vollzeitstellen in der Software-Entwicklung zu finden. Hier sind viele tolle Unternehmen auf der Suche nach Talenten wie uns, also schau regelmäßig vorbei und bewirb dich direkt über die Website.

Such dir Mentoren und Feedback!

Hol dir Feedback von erfahrenen Entwicklern, die dir Tipps geben können, was Recruiter wirklich suchen. Ob über LinkedIn oder persönliche Kontakte: Menschen, die sich in der Branche auskennen, können enorm wertvoll sein, um dir zu helfen, dich optimal auf deine Bewerbung bei Anthropic vorzubereiten!

Wir glauben, dass du diese Fähigkeiten brauchst, um Software Engineer, Account Abuse mit Bravour zu bestehen

Python
SQL
Datenanalyse
Kommunikationsfähigkeiten
Systemintegration
Überwachungsdashboards erstellen
Root Cause Analysis

Einige Tipps für deine Bewerbung 🫡

Highlights deiner Coding-Skills:In der Software-Entwicklung kommt es auf konkrete Fähigkeiten an. Vergiss nicht, relevante Programmiersprachen und Frameworks in deinen Lebenslauf aufzunehmen. Zeig uns, was du kannst – vielleicht mit einem Link zu deinem GitHub-Profil oder einer Übersicht deiner Side Projects, die deine Programmierkenntnisse illustrieren.

Dokumentation deiner Erfolge:Gerade bei einer Vollzeitstelle in der Software-Entwicklung sind konkrete Ergebnisse Gold wert. Nenn uns Zahlen und Ergebnisse aus deinen vorherigen Projekten. Hast du den Code optimiert oder Systemfehler behoben? Solche Erfolge zeigen, dass du die Sprache der Entwickler sprichst und einen echten Mehrwert bringst.

Attraktive Projektbeschreibungen:Wenn du an Projekten gearbeitet hast, die hervorstechen, beschreibe sie ausführlich in deinem Lebenslauf. Was war das Problem, das du gelöst hast? Welche Technologien hast du eingesetzt? Das gibt uns einen klaren Einblick in deine Herangehensweise und Problemlösungsfähigkeiten.

Motivation zeigen:In deinem Anschreiben solltest du deine Motivation für die Stelle im Bereich Software-Entwicklung bei Anthropic klar herausstellen. Warum sprichst gerade du die Anforderungen für diese Vollzeitrolle an? Mach deutlich, was dich an der Arbeit bei uns reizt und wie du über das rein Technische hinaus wachsen möchtest.

Wie man sich auf ein Vorstellungsgespräch bei Anthropic vorbereitet

Technische Vorbereitung auf die Coding-Challenges

In der Software-Entwicklung sind technische Fragen oft ein zentraler Teil des Interviews. Macht euch mit Plattformen wie LeetCode oder HackerRank vertraut, um eure Problemlösungsfähigkeiten zu trainieren. Zeigt im Interview viel Selbstbewusstsein beim Erklären eurer Ansätze!

Das eigene Portfolio im besten Licht präsentieren

Stellt sicher, dass ihr ein aussagekräftiges Portfolio habt, das einige eurer besten Projekte zeigt. Seid bereit, darüber zu sprechen, was eure Rolle war, welche Technologien ihr verwendet habt und welche Herausforderungen es gab. Das gibt den Interviewern einen Einblick in eure praktische Erfahrung.

Teamfähigkeit und Kommunikation betonen

In einer Vollzeit-Position wird Kommunikation im Team sehr wichtig sein. Seid bereit, Beispiele aus der Vergangenheit zu teilen, in denen ihr effektiv im Team gearbeitet habt. Dies zeigt, dass ihr nicht nur technische Fähigkeiten habt, sondern auch gut ins Team passt.

Vorbereitung auf Fragen zur Software-Architektur

Bereitet euch darauf vor, Fragen zur Software-Architektur zu beantworten. Themen wie RESTful APIs, Microservices und Cloud-Architekturen können Teil eures Interviews sein. Zeigt euer Verständnis durch Diskussionen und Beispiele aus eurer bisherigen Arbeit oder Projekte.